Q: Is 25,505,548 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 25,505,548 is a composite number.

Why is 25,505,548 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 25,505,548 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 6,376,387 12,752,774 and 25,505,548, with no remainder.

Since 25,505,548 cannot be divided by just 1 and 25,505,548, it is a composite number.
